Nick Line joins CFC as Chief Underwriting Officer

14th January 2026 - Author: Kassandra Jimenez-Sanchez -

Share

Specialist insurance provider, CFC has announced the appointment of Nick Line as Chief Underwriting Officer (CUO), taking over the role from Matt Taylor, who has served as interim CUO since February 2025.

cfc-logoA former CUO at Markel International, Line brings a wealth of actuarial expertise and a track record of managing multi-billion-pound portfolios to CFC.

His ability to build high-performing, international teams will be instrumental as the company scales its international operations.

Louise O’Shea, Group CEO at CFC, said: “We are delighted to welcome Nick at such an exciting time in CFC’s growth story, and his appointment underlines our continued commitment to profitable and sustainable performance for the long term.

“His technical acumen, global perspective, and inclusive leadership style make him the ideal person to lead our underwriting teams into the next chapter.”

Commenting on his appointment, Nick Line said: “I am pleased to be joining CFC at such an exciting time for the business. CFC’s reputation for innovation, customer focus, and market leadership is second to none. I look forward to working with CFC’s talented underwriting teams to build on this momentum and help drive the business towards its ambitious goals.”
